A native of Dayton and a graduate of Fairview High School, Michael Lieberman has been the Washington Counsel for the Anti-Defamation League (ADL) since January 1989. ADL has been fighting anti-Semitism, racism and all forms of bigotry through advocacy and anti-bias education programs since 1913. Michael previously worked for two members of Congress, including former Dayton-area representative Tony Hall. He is a graduate of the University of Michigan and Duke Law School, where he served as a member of the Duke Law Journal. He has helped draft hate crime and bullying prevention laws and led the broad coalition of civil rights, religious, law enforcement and civic organizations that worked for 13 years to enact the Matthew Shepard and James Byrd Jr. Hate Crimes Prevention Act. He will discuss how, while we cannot outlaw hate, we can change attitudes and behaviors by working together — making a positive difference in our families and communities.

In the spirit of ideas worth spreading, TEDx is a program of local, self-organized events that bring people together to share a TED-like experience. At a TEDx event, TEDTalks video and live speakers combine to spark deep discussion and connection in a small group. These local, self-organized events are branded TEDx, where x = independently organized TED event. The TED Conference provides general guidance for the TEDx program, but individual TEDx events are self-organized.* (*Subject to certain rules and regulations)
